Landfall - final mission

Level 2
Can't solve final mission, plz help!
player have to shoot a missile, but how? i hit it with turret fire, but nothing happens! I did it lot if times with different ways....


Level 12
Oh gosh, it's been so long since I've played... I know there were some sort of targets (lights or generators or somesuch) up on the walls and IIRC, you had to deploy a medium-sized mech into sniper-turret mode in order to shoot those, instead of the missile itself?  (small mechs deployed as the machinegun turret might have also worked)

I think there might have been a part, after you do all of that, where you have to pick up an Anti-Air Missile and use that on one of the big missiles as it's firing out?
